General Description
The MAX9715 high-efficiency, stereo, Class D audio
power amplifier provides up to 2.8W per channel into a
4Ω speaker with a 5V supply. Maxim’s second-generation
Class D technology features robust output protection,
high efficiency, and high power-supply rejection (PSRR)
while eliminating the need for output filters. Selectable
gain settings, +10.5dB or +9.0dB, adjust the amplifier
gain to suit the audio input level and speaker load.
The MAX9715 features high PSRR (71dB at 1kHz),
allowing for operation from noisy supplies without addi-
tional regulation. Comprehensive click-and-pop sup-
pression eliminates audible clicks and pops at startup
and shutdown. The MAX9715 operates from a single 5V
supply and consumes only 12mA of supply current.
Integrated shutdown control reduces supply current to
less than 100nA.
The MAX9715 is fully specified over the extended
-40°C to +85°C temperature range and is available in a
thermally enhanced 16-pin TQFN-EP package.

Features
5V Single-Supply Operation
Spread-Spectrum Modulator Reduces EMI
2.8W, Class D, Stereo Speaker Amplifier (4Ω)
Filterless Class D Requires No LC Output Filter
High PSRR (71dB at 1kHz)

Low-Power Shutdown Mode
Integrated Click-and-Pop Suppression
Low Total Harmonic Distortion: 0.06% at 1kHz
Short-Circuit and Thermal Protection
Internal Gain, +9.0dB or +10.5dB
Available in Space-Saving Package
16-Pin Thin QFN-EP (5mm x 5mm x 0.8mm)
